1. Put the garlic, soy sauce, sugar and oil in a mini food processor and process until the garlic is pureed. Put the pork chops on a rimmed baking sheet and pour the marinade over them; turn to coat the chops. Let stand at room temperature for 15 to 30 minutes. 2. Light a grill.

Thịt Kho Tàu is a salty-sweet dish of caramelized pork belly and marinated eggs. Hailing from South Vietnam, this flavorful dish is beloved amongst those both Vietnamese and non-Vietnamese alike.
